Adenza Group
Adenza Group, based in New York, is an asset manager with an investment mandate concentrated on financial technology and enterprise software serving capital markets, risk management, and regulatory compliance. The firm targets majority or significant minority stakes in businesses that provide critical infrastructure for financial institutions. Likely asset-class mix includes direct equity investments, growth capital, and buyout-style control positions. No specific portfolio companies or co-investors were identifiable from public records. Team size, additional offices, and total assets under management are not publicly available. No recent operational events or philanthropic vehicles were identified. The firm maintains a low public profile, typical of asset managers operating in the B2B financial technology space. Adenza Group's structural differentiator lies in its narrow sector focus on financial infrastructure software — a vertical that demands deep domain expertise in regulation, risk modeling, and real-time data processing — rather than generalist technology investing. This specialization may provide a defensible source of proprietary deal flow, though the firm's sourcing model remains opaque.
